Are you looking for a sturdy tote that doesn't look like it came from a catalog? Tread lightly on the earth and keep the wind at your back with a recycled sailcloth tote from Sea Bags. Since 1999, the company has turned old sails into custom bags.
Each bag has a cotton rope handle hand-spliced at the shop in Portland, Maine. There are three sizes, including a limited edition Pink Ribbon bag -- 50% of the $125 purchase price goes to the Maine Cancer Foundation. If you happen have a used sail lying around, Sea Bags will gladly trade you a bag for your castaway -- or if you don't need a bag, the company will make a donation to a children's sailing school in your honor.
